Stomach (Gastric) Cancer Prevention (PDQ®)–Health Professional Version

cancer  prevention  health  version  professional  stomach  gastric  gastric cancer  cancer prevention 

Risk factors for stomach (gastric) cancer include certain health conditions (e.g., atrophic gastritis, pernicious anemia, H. pylori infection), genetic factors (e.g., Li-Fraumeni syndrome), or environmental factors (e.g., diet, smoking). Review the evidence on these and other risk factors and interventions to prevent stomach cancer in this expert-reviewed summary.

Stomach (Gastric) Cancer Screening (PDQ®)–Health Professional Version

cancer  health  screening  version  professional  stomach  gastric  disease screening  gastric cancer 

For stomach (gastric) cancer, there is no standard or routine screening test for the general U.S. population. Review the evidence on the benefits and harms of screening for gastric cancer using barium-meal photofluorography, gastric endoscopy, or serum pepsinogen in this expert-reviewed summary.
